Connie & Robbie
Finally made a trip to Gin Rummy. We loves a good tiki bar and this one is not bad. The drinks we had were excellent. We got the nui nui and the scorpion sting. The scorpion had a nice spicy kick at the end of each sip but was front loaded with sweet juicyness. It was lovely. We also got shrimp tacos and carne asada and the cauliflower and the smokey Caesar salad. The tacos were serviceable if a bit dry. Decent flavor. The person who ordered the salad loved it. A live DJ was spinning yacht rock and the volume was way high for us olds; had a little trouble conversing. But the mostly young crowd had no issues. Love the 4 pinball machines that take credit cards and not quarters. $1 gets you 5 balls. Valet or street parking only. Would go back as it is a great place for a small group hang.
